Dave Pearson
c436b57ed5
Merge branch 'main' into checkbox-switch
2023-02-09 13:57:15 +00:00
Will McGugan
f450d98e3e
snapshot
2023-02-09 11:55:36 +00:00
Will McGugan
3a9c052d20
Added snapshot
2023-02-09 11:49:11 +00:00
Dave Pearson
decc1e2f3c
Rename Checkbox to Switch
...
A new form of Checkbox will be arriving in Textual soon, working in
conjunction with a RadioButton. What was called Checkbox is perhaps a wee
bit heavyweight in terms of visual design, but is a style of widget that
should remain.
With this in mind we're renaming the current Checkbox to Switch. In all
other respects its workings remains the same, only the name has changed.
Things for people to watch out for:
- Imports will need to be updated.
- Queries will need to be updated; special attention will need to be paid to
any queries that are string-based.
- CSS will need to be changed if any Checkbox styling is happening, or if
any Checkbox component styles are being used.
See #1725 as the initial motivation and #1746 as the issue for this
particular change.
2023-02-09 11:10:30 +00:00
Will McGugan
5930ebf82e
remove _typing.py
2023-02-07 10:46:28 +00:00
Dave Pearson
6f24331564
Merge pull request #1703 from davep/lowkey-tree-selection
...
Lowkey tree selection
2023-01-31 16:27:15 +00:00
Dave Pearson
b0a29050cf
Update snapshots after change of unfocused tree cursor handling
2023-01-31 16:20:41 +00:00
Rodrigo Girão Serrão
40fde8cfb9
Merge pull request #1610 from Textualize/fix-1607
...
Fix #1607 to allow programmatic style changes
2023-01-31 15:13:24 +00:00
Will McGugan
e446695684
snapshot fix
2023-01-31 12:53:32 +01:00
Will McGugan
330db5fc80
snapshot
2023-01-31 12:43:07 +01:00
Will McGugan
be5a67e903
fix auto width glitch
2023-01-31 12:13:25 +01:00
Will McGugan
71a0a6676f
docstring [skip ci]
2023-01-30 19:02:35 +01:00
Will McGugan
4aa988347f
add tests
2023-01-30 18:59:23 +01:00
Will McGugan
88b155132b
Merge branch 'main' into scroll-sensitivity
2023-01-30 15:59:49 +01:00
Rodrigo Girão Serrão
b023d4e02e
Improve tests.
2023-01-30 12:34:35 +00:00
Will McGugan
0e01651825
Merge branch 'main' into scroll-sensitivity
2023-01-30 13:18:47 +01:00
Will McGugan
eb91fc0579
snapshot fix
2023-01-30 13:01:44 +01:00
Will McGugan
b4a3c2e8bb
fix for render width
2023-01-28 17:23:52 +01:00
Will McGugan
41be84b1a5
docstring
2023-01-26 16:01:48 +01:00
Will McGugan
2b3d966410
moar pauses
2023-01-23 12:31:18 +01:00
Will McGugan
81d086e8d7
fix snapshot test
2023-01-23 12:11:05 +01:00
Darren Burns
36bf162847
Snapshot tests for column and row cursors in DataTable
2023-01-17 14:17:25 +00:00
Darren Burns
b4f2da025a
Add pause after datatable snapshot test
2023-01-16 16:40:01 +00:00
Darren Burns
65223be8be
Merge branch 'main' of github.com:Textualize/textual into datatable-events
2023-01-16 11:00:10 +00:00
Darren Burns
62c05f7fbc
Update datatable snapshot - hover cursor no longer shown
2023-01-16 10:01:02 +00:00
Will McGugan
027635b978
merge
2023-01-12 17:45:36 +00:00
Rodrigo Girão Serrão
dd478dd249
Make list_view snapshot test pass more reliably
2023-01-12 15:00:56 +00:00
Rodrigo Girão Serrão
d9a0c343d7
Update snapshot tests.
2023-01-09 16:42:15 +00:00
Rodrigo Girão Serrão
e5375d0a2f
Reset color cycle before tests.
...
We need to reset the color cycle for placeholders before each CSS property test because we need to ensure consistent colouring of the placeholders as tests are added/removed/reordered.
2023-01-09 16:26:33 +00:00
Rodrigo Girão Serrão
4c3eb3e021
Update placeholder snapshot test.
...
Although there was no visual difference in the output, the snapshot tool was complaining because there are now less things to draw on the screen, thus the snapshots looked different. Hence, the placeholder snapshot needed to be updated.
2023-01-07 09:35:41 +00:00
Will McGugan
91e23ff34c
more pauses for demo?
2022-12-30 17:31:36 +00:00
Will McGugan
97627107cf
add pause
2022-12-30 15:01:57 +00:00
Will McGugan
57654a90bf
fix snapshot
2022-12-29 10:23:34 +00:00
Will McGugan
6f82ad9c4a
adds Strip primitive
2022-12-26 18:06:35 +00:00
Will McGugan
6c5ba82bff
fix for win
2022-12-21 15:43:43 +00:00
Will McGugan
1cef349f27
test fix
2022-12-20 14:06:35 +00:00
Will McGugan
301d56e329
snapshot fix
2022-12-20 13:22:22 +00:00
Will McGugan
93716e714b
Merge branch 'main' into nested-height-fix
2022-12-20 11:14:45 +00:00
Will McGugan
b265b855cd
insert pause
2022-12-19 13:39:03 +00:00
Will McGugan
bb7fd40d73
force console on terminal summary
2022-12-19 13:26:47 +00:00
Will McGugan
43ed1d5927
fix snapshot
2022-12-19 13:00:42 +00:00
Will McGugan
32b7308ac8
fox for nested heights
2022-12-19 12:54:06 +00:00
Will McGugan
002cbab0d5
add pause to action
2022-12-19 11:26:42 +00:00
Will McGugan
053b7f38e1
snapshot tweak
2022-12-19 10:27:29 +00:00
Darren Burns
e01c33c06a
Snapshot updates
2022-12-14 14:21:41 +00:00
Darren Burns
1acc36084b
Add non-printable key to footer snapshot
2022-12-14 14:07:26 +00:00
Will McGugan
f51234498a
tweaked placeholder
2022-12-10 18:00:43 +00:00
Will McGugan
c76d616521
updated snapshot
2022-12-10 17:54:57 +00:00
Will McGugan
5af3470728
update snapshot
2022-12-10 10:44:02 +00:00
Will McGugan
24a182c104
fix snapshot
2022-12-09 10:22:26 +00:00